House Priceson Long Lane

Sale prices range from £167,820 for 1 bedroom leasehold flats (247 ft2) to £1,340,001 for 3 bedroom leasehold flats (1,291 ft2) .

Monthly rental prices range from £876 pcm for 1 bed flats to £4,669 pcm for 3 bed flats.

The gross rental yield is between 3.9% and 6.7%.

The average value per square foot is £614.

Sales History
on Long Lane, London, N3

The last sale was on 5th February 2026 for £800,000 and since then the market in the area has decreased by 0.5%. The street has had a total of 359 sales since 1995.

Long Lane, London, N3 has seen 26 sales in the last three years and 6 sales in the last twelve months.
